QT62T11M-20.000MHZ Overview

CRYSTAL OSCILLATOR, CLOCK, TTL OUTPUT

QT62T11M-20.000MHZ Parametric

Parameter NameAttribute value
Is it Rohs certified?conform to
package instructionROHS COMPLIANT, HERMETIC SEALED, LEADLESS, CERAMIC, SMD, 44 PIN
Reach Compliance Codecompliant
Other featuresTAPE AND REEL
maximum descent time6 ns
Frequency Adjustment - MechanicalNO
frequency stability50%
JESD-609 codee4
Installation featuresSURFACE MOUNT
Nominal operating frequency20 MHz
Maximum operating temperature85 °C
Minimum operating temperature-40 °C
Oscillator typeTTL
Output load6 TTL
physical size16.51mm x 16.51mm x 2.16mm
longest rise time6 ns
Maximum supply voltage5.5 V
Minimum supply voltage4.5 V
Nominal supply voltage5 V
surface mountYES
maximum symmetry40/60 %
Terminal surfaceGold (Au) - with Nickel (Ni) barrier
Base Number Matches1

Features
• Made in the USA
• ECCN: EAR99
• DFARS 252-225-7014 Compliant:
Electronic Component Exemption
• USML Registration # M17677
• Wide frequency range from 732.4Hz to 150MHz
• Available as QPL MIL-PRF-55310/19 (QT66T), /20
(QT62T), and /29 (QT66HCD)
• Choice of packages and pin outs
• Choice of supply voltages
• Choice of output logic options ( CMOS, ACMOS,
HCMOS, LVHCMOS, TTL, ECL, PECL, and
LVPECL)
• A
T-Cut crystal
• True SMD hermetically sealed package
• Tight or custom symmetry available
• Low height available
• External tuning capacitor option
• Fundamental and third overtone designs
• Tristate function option D
• Four-point crystal mounts
• Custom design available tailors to meet customer’s
needs
• Q-Tech does not use pure lead or pure tin in its
products
• RoHS compliant
